Online Biotechnology Courses
These online courses were developed through a three campus collaboration involving San Jose State University, CSU San Marcos, and CSU Channel Islands.
Biol 601 Seminar in Biotechnology and Bioinformatics — Latest Technological Developments (Winter 2010)
Stem Cell Research (Summer 2010)
Biol 503 Biotechnology and Law Regulation — Individual and organizational responsibility in R&D and commercial aspects of biotechnology. Topics include: intellectual property, privacy, government and industrial regulation, liability, ethics, and policy responses to societal concerns in the U.S. and abroad. Case studies involving gene therapy, cloning, and biomaterials in the medical and health sector, and farming and crop modification in the agricultural sector will be explored in detail.
Biol 227T Pharmacology and Toxicology — Principles of pharmacology, especially as related to the pharmaceutical industry and clinical applications.
Biol 500 Introduction to Biopharmaceutical Productions — An introduction to biopharmaceutical production systems and processes.
Binf 500 DNA & Protein Sequence Analysis — This course will introduce the computational aspects of biological inference from nucleic acid and protein sequences.
Biol 516 Clinical Trials and Quality Assurance — An introduction to the foundational knowledge and skills necessary to successfully conduct clinical trials for new drugs, biologics, and medical devices, including in vitro diagnostics.

The aerospace engineers are concerned with the design,
analysis, construction, testing and operation of flight vehicles,
including aircrafts, helicopters, rockets and spacecrafts. The
course is based on the fundamentals of fluid dynamics,
materials science, structural analysis, propulsion, aerospace
design, automatic control and guidance, and development of
computer software.
With increase in growth and associated industrial potential,
Indian agriculture has now been accorded the status of an
industry. The course on Agricultural and Food Engineering
aims at producing engineering graduates to meet the
requirement of technical manpower in development of farm
machines, land and water resources management,
agricultural production and manufacture of processed food.
In order to meet the present demand of agricultural and food
industries, the course has been suitably modified to include
specialized training in design, development, testing and
selection of tractors and farm implements, irrigation, drainage
and watershed management using Remote Sensing and GIS;
information technology, processing of food, fodder and fibre,
utilization of biomass, byproducts and wastes in the production
of biochemicals, fuels, manure and non-conventional energy.
The course provides ample flexibility to the students for
acquiring expertise in any of the three major areas of
specialization, namely, Farm Power and Machinery, Soil and
Water Conservation Engineering, and Food Process
Engineering.

chemical engineering
Chemical engineers work in diverse fields like petroleum
refining, fertilizer technology, processing of food and
agricultural products, synthetic food, petrochemicals,
synthetic fibres, coal and mineral based industries, and
prevention and control of environmental pollution. Chemical
engineering is concerned with the development and
improvement of processes, design, construction, operation,
management and safety of the plants for these processes
and research in these areas.

Some chemical engineers make designs and invent new processes. Some construct instruments and facilities. Some plan and operate facilities. Chemical engineers have helped develop atomic science, polymers, paper, dyes, drugs, plastics, fertilizers, foods, petrochemicals… pretty much everything. They devise ways to make products from raw materials and ways to convert one material into another useful form. Chemical engineers can make processes more cost effective or more environmentally friendly or more efficient.
